Hilton Foods Canada is set to build a $192 million food processing and distribution facility at Brantford, creating 150 new jobs. This will be the first North American facility for the company. Drake Meats has announced plans to build a 53,000 square foot state-of-the-art meat processing facility in Saskatoon, Sask., capable of producing more than eight million kilograms of pork and beef products annually.
